Taranaki’s State Highway 3 Closed After Severe Weather Causes Slips
Heavy rainfall overnight has led to multiple landslips and flooding on State Highway 3, resulting in the closure of a key route north from Taranaki. Vehicles are reported to be stuck in the Awakino Gorge, with local authorities urging motorists to avoid the area until conditions improve.
According to a statement from police, the adverse weather has caused significant disruption, making parts of the highway impassable. Officers are on-site and have confirmed that some vehicles remain unable to move due to the slips.
The NZ Transport Agency, known as Waka Kotahi, issued a Facebook update on Tuesday morning, indicating that the highway is closed from Mōkau to Piopio. They advised drivers to delay their journeys if possible and consider alternative routes. The agency stated, “The road will remain closed for several hours while crews clear the area.”
Waka Kotahi is expected to provide further updates later in the day, with the next report anticipated by late Tuesday afternoon.
This is not the first instance of severe weather impacting State Highway 3. In June, the same highway was closed for nearly 24 hours near Awakino after a mudslide obstructed traffic. The ongoing weather conditions highlight the vulnerability of this route and the need for caution among travelers in the region.
As contractors work to clear the debris and restore safe passage, authorities emphasize the importance of adhering to traffic advisories and staying informed about road conditions.
